Explore intrusion detection techniques for high-speed networks in this 57-minute Black Hat USA 2000 conference talk presented by Mark Kadrich. Gain insights into the challenges and solutions for implementing effective security measures in fast-paced network environments. Learn about cutting-edge methodologies and tools designed to identify and mitigate potential threats in real-time, ensuring robust protection for high-performance systems. Discover how to adapt traditional intrusion detection strategies to meet the demands of modern, high-speed network infrastructures.
